In the last ten years, the area that has suffered because of wildfire disasters in the European Union has fluctuated a lot, with some extreme years being particularly noticeable. Based on information from the European Forest Fire Information System (EFFIS), which works under the Copernicus Emergency Management Service, the total burnt area from bigger fires (around 30 hectares or more) for the EU27 was:
| Year | Burnt Area (hectares) | Notes |
|---|---|---|
| 2016 | ~180,000 | Near or below average |
| 2017 | 988,524 | Previous record year |
| 2018 | ~175,000 | Relatively quiet |
| 2019 | ~220,000 | Above average |
| 2020 | ~230,000 | Near average |
| 2021 | ~550,000 | Well above average |
| 2022 | ~800,000 | One of the worst seasons |
| 2023 | ~500,000 | 4th largest on record |
| 2024 | ~400,000 | Still above long-term average |
| 2025 | 1,034,552 to 1,079,538 | New record |
The wildfire season in 2025 has established a new record of being the most destructive in Europe in terms of total burnt area and carbon emissions, breaking the previous record made in 2017, although 2017 and 2018 were the deadliest due to the high tragic loss in some areas, like in Portugal and Greece.
The average yearly number of acres burnt from 2006 to 2024 has been equal to 350,000 to 400,000.
Note that these statistics only reflect 27 EU member countries and only wildfires equal to or more than 30 hectares in size which have been detected via satellite methods.
